That stinks that you and your DH have to go so far to a cancer center to have MOHS done. It was just done "in-house" in my local dermatology office, but they do have a dedicated section just for MOHS surgery, and I'm assuming that's not the case with other dermatology centers. I had both external and dissolving sutures - the external were on top and the nurse stated they use those because they tend to see less scarring, so since it is on the nose, they try everything to make sure scarring is minimal. I had Mohs surgery on my cheek 12/29/21 and everything went fine initially. I had little pain but increased the next four days. It feels like I had a root canal. My teeth even hurt when I ate. Ice seemed to help but gradually had to take a Hydrocodone pain pill that helped finally. Going to call the doc tomorrow to see if anything else is happening...will update!
